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Trimley to Penzance start from as little as £30.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Trimley to Penzance start from £181.30 one way, or £182.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Trimley to Penzance are available for £230.20 one way, or £404.10 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Trimley Station

At Trimley station, convenience is key—though there isn’t a ticket office on-site, ticket machines are readily available, and you can collect tickets bought online right on the platform. Accessibility is a priority as well, with step-free access throughout the station ensuring an easy journey for everyone, including those with mobility constraints. An accessible ticket machine, induction loop, and ramps for train access reinforce this facility, making sure you travel with ease.

Safety and information are handled with care: the station is equipped with CCTV, and there are customer help points for any inquiries. Whilst you wait, you can enjoy the seating area thoughtfully provided, although it's worth noting there are no waiting rooms or toilets available—so plan accordingly!

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Trimley station connects effortlessly with other modes of transport. For instance, in the event of rail disruptions, a rail replacement bus service will pick you up at the junction of High Road and Station Road. While the station doesn’t offer facilities like taxis or car hire on-site, local arrangements can easily be made to further enhance your onward journey. If you're cycling in, you'll find three cycle stands available on Platform 1 for convenience, though there is no bicycle hire service at the station.

Exploring Penzance Train Station

Nestled in the picturesque Cornish coastline, Penzance Train Station serves as the end of the line on the Great Western Main Line, marking the most southwesterly point of rail travel in Britain. Known for its blend of historic charm and modern conveniences, the station is an ideal starting point for both local adventures and longer journeys throughout the UK. Whether you're here for a seaside getaway or simply passing through, Penzance Station offers a gateway to a region steeped in natural beauty and cultural heritage.

Station Facilities and Ticketing

For those planning a trip from Penzance, the station boasts a wide array of amenities to make your travel experience comfortable and convenient. The ticket office is open from 6:45 am to 7:30 pm on weekdays, 6:15 am to 6:10 pm on Saturdays, and 8:45 am to 5:30 pm on Sundays. For those tech-savvy travelers, ticket machines including accessible ones are available for purchasing and collecting tickets, with induction loops installed to assist those with hearing impairments. While smartcards can be issued here, there are no smartcard validators available at the station.

Accessibility and Assistance

Penzance Station is committed to ensuring access for all passengers. It offers step-free access throughout, making all parts of the station easily navigable for those with mobility impairments. Staff assistance is available almost around the clock during weekdays and Saturdays, with slightly reduced hours on Sundays. Ramps, help points, and wheelchairs are part of the station's offering to enhance accessibility. Although accessible toilets and lounges are not provided, the station ensures that help is always at hand.

Onward Travel Options

Besides the train services, Penzance Station provides several options for onward travel to explore the scenic surroundings. The bus station is conveniently located adjacent to the train station, ensuring passengers can seamlessly continue their journeys. For cyclists, there's Penzance Bike Hire located in the town center.
